Yes Malaka, we can achieve this feature without additional code change. We should give the value for transport.vfs.SubFolderTimestampFormat as "*yyyy/* *MM/dd*" rather using other values like "EEE MMM dd HH:mm:ss Z yyyy". Can we mention this on documentation. Please find the PR [1].
